WebLake Victoria. The largest lake in Africa and chief reservoir of the Nile River, this freshwater body has an area of 26,828 square miles (69,484 square km), which makes it one of the largest freshwater lakes in the world. Web1 aug. 2024 · Angola is Africa’s seventh largest country with an area of 481,400 square miles, and the 23 rd largest country in the world. It is twice the size of Texas. Area 481,351 square mi (1,246,700 square km) Population 22.14 million 2014. Capital Luanda. Highest Point 8,594 ft (2,620 m) Lowest Point 0 m. GDP $131.4 billion 2014.
